I imagine that a large percentage of OAA students are sold the dream of working for the national flag carrier. BA have taken on 13 so far and I would guess that the year end figure is around 20 - 25 'graduates'.

Would you gamble 25k on a 10% chance of landing a job with BA? Disregarding FR, the next big company to hire from OAA is FlyBe. With all due respect to FlyBe pilots, their FO salary is not as competitive as the likes of EZY, FR etc. You'll need every penny you can get to pay off that 75k of debt.

Personally I'd rather go modular & save 30k+
